Cherry (Senile) Hemangioma (Fig.2.8)
Denition Most common skin vascular lesion of adults.
Age at Presentation From middle adulthood, increasing with age.
Gender No sex predilection.
Localization Trunk>upper extremities.
Clinical Presentation Small red papules that increase in number with age.
Microscopy Polypoid lesion within the supercial dermis consisting of dilated
congested capillaries/venules, with thickened wall. No brous capsule. Thinning of

the overlying epidermis. Epidermal collarette often present. No lobular pattern. Rare mitoses (Fig.2.9a, b).

Immunohistochemistry No particular changes.
Molecular Genetics GNA14/GNAQ/GNA11 mutations have been described.
Prognosis Benign lesion.
Differential Diagnosis (1) Lobular capillary hemangioma in adulthood: cherry
hemangioma lacks lobular architecture and mitoses are rare or absent.
Microvenular Hemangioma (Fig.2.10)
Denition Rare benign cutaneous vascular tumor, characterized by a predilection
for the limbs of young adults.
Age at Presentation Mean age: 39 years. Range: 1–70 years. Young adults> children>elderly people.
Gender No sex predilection.
Localization Extremities (limbs)>chest>back>abdomen.
Clinical Presentation Asymptomatic, stable or slow-growing, plaque or nodule,
one to few centimeters in diameter, red to purple in color.
Histology It is a dermal poorly circumscribed lesion without lobulation. Thin
venules, irregularly branched, compressed by the surrounding sclerotic reticular

dermis. The thin compressed veins are encircled by a prominent layer of pericytes. Endothelium is plump. No atypia. No mitosis. The involvement of the arrector pili muscle is a typical feature (Fig.2.11a, b).

Immunohistochemistry Strong alpha-SMA reactivity around each compressed
vascular structure is a classical nding (Fig.2.12a, b).

Molecular Genetics Not useful.
Prognosis Benign lesion.
Differential Diagnosis (1) Kaposi sarcoma (patch stage): erythrocyte
extravasation; hemosiderin deposits; lymphoplasmocytic inltrate; a spindle cell component; immunoreactivity for HHV8; lack of alpha-SMA-reactive pericytes.
Caveat At low power, in cases in which the involved dermis is particularly dense
and sclerotic, compressed venules may not be easily identied, leading to a diagnosis of “normal skin.” A careful, high-power-eld examination may be mandatory in order to reach a correct diagnosis.
Cavernous Hemangioma (Fig.2.13)
Denition Benign vascular tumor consisting of enlarged, thin-walled blood
vessels.
Age at Presentation Infancy>childhood>adulthood.

Localization The scalp, face, and neck are the most common sites, but these
tumors have been found in organs and bone.
Clinical Presentation It presents as a soft, bluish mass. Large cavernous hemangiomas may be associated with consumptive coagulopathy, characterized by low-serum brinogen levels and high D-dimer levels, due to activation of coagulation inside the lesion.
Macroscopy
A bluish soft area with a spongy consistency.
Histology Circumscribed proliferation of dilated thin-walled congested vessels
(Fig.2.14).
Variants (A) Sinusoidal hemangioma (Fig.2.15). It has a preferential localization
in the subcutaneous tissue of the mammary gland. The histological picture is

characterized by widely dilated vascular channels (sinusoids) and by back-to-back congested thin vessels with thrombi. Foamy macrophages and cholesterol clefts are often present (Fig.2.16a, b).
Immunohistochemistry No particular patterns.
Molecular Genetics No recurrent changes.
Prognosis
Benign lesion. Treatment includes observation, irradiation, sclerosing
solutions, and laser surgery and excisional surgery.

Arteriovenous Hemangioma (Fig.2.17)
Denition Also known as cirsoid aneurism, it is considered a venous hemangioma
in which some vessels undergo arterialization, with a preferential location in the face.
Age at Presentation > 40years (adulthood).
Gender No sex predilection.
Localization Lips>perioral region>nose>eyelids.
Clinical Course Small, dome-shaped, dermal red-blue lesion, mainly arising in
the face.
Microscopy Well dened but unencapsulated. Thin vein-like vessels; thick
bromuscular artery-like vessels, devoid of elastic lamina; few capillaries. Frequent intravascular thrombi. Papillary endothelial hyperplasia and dystrophic calcications may be present (Fig.2.18a, b).
Immunohistochemistry No diagnostic role.
Molecular Genetics MAP2K1 mutations have been described.
Prognosis Benign lesion. Surgery is curative.
